Sourdeval (French pronunciation: [suʁdəval]) is a commune in the Manche department in Normandy in north-western France. On 1 January 2016, the former commune of Vengeons was merged into Sourdeval.[3]

Geography

The commune is made up of the following collection of villages and hamlets, Vengeons, La Fourberie, Loraire, Sourdeval, La Besnardière, La Moinerie, La Barre and La Richardière.[4]

The source of the river Sée is in this commune.[5] In addition the river Égrenne flows through the commune.[6]

Heraldry

Arms of Sourdeval
Arms of Sourdeval
The arms of Sourdeval are blazoned :
Or fretty sable, a canton of the second.
